How MRI Technology Works

Magnetic resonance imaging is a non-invasive scanning technique that utilizes strong magnets and radio waves to create detailed images of the brain. Unlike other imaging methods, MRI does not employ radiation, making it a safer option for repeated use. During the scanning process, patients lie inside a tube-shaped machine while the system collects multiple images of the brain from various angles. These images allow healthcare professionals to visualize the size, shape, and structure of brain tissues with remarkable clarity.

The technology works by detecting the magnetic properties of hydrogen atoms in water molecules within the body. When placed in a strong magnetic field, these atoms align in a specific direction. Radio waves are then used to temporarily disrupt this alignment, and as the atoms return to their natural state, they emit signals that are detected by the MRI scanner. These signals are processed by computers to generate cross-sectional images of the brain that can be examined for abnormalities.

Types of MRI Scans Relevant to Mental Health

Several variations of MRI technology are particularly relevant to mental health assessment:

Structural MRI provides detailed images of brain anatomy, allowing clinicians to examine the physical structure of various brain regions. This type of imaging can reveal differences in brain size, shape, and tissue composition that may be associated with certain mental health conditions.

Functional MRI (fMRI) represents a more advanced approach by measuring changes in blood flow throughout the brain. By detecting areas of increased blood oxygenation, fMRI can track brain activity while a person performs specific tasks or at rest. This capability enables researchers and clinicians to observe which brain regions are active during various cognitive and emotional processes.

Diffusion Tensor Imaging (DTI) is a specialized MRI technique that maps the brain's white matter tracts, which serve as communication pathways between different brain regions. This method is particularly valuable for studying brain connectivity, which has been implicated in various psychiatric disorders.

High-field MRI scanners, such as 7 Tesla systems, offer even greater image resolution and contrast than conventional MRI machines. These advanced scanners provide more detailed views of brain structures, potentially revealing subtle abnormalities that might be missed with lower-strength equipment.

What MRIs Can Reveal About Mental Health Conditions

Brain imaging has provided valuable insights into the neurological underpinnings of various mental health conditions. While MRI cannot diagnose mental illness on its own, it can reveal patterns and abnormalities that may be associated with specific disorders.

For individuals with depression, structural MRI may reveal changes in the prefrontal cortex and white matter. Functional imaging might show altered patterns of activity in regions involved in mood regulation. These findings, while not diagnostic, can contribute to a more comprehensive understanding of the condition and potentially inform treatment approaches.

In cases of bipolar disorder, MRI can detect differences in gray matter volume and blood flow patterns in areas related to emotional processing. While these findings are not specific enough to confirm a diagnosis, they may help differentiate bipolar disorder from other conditions with similar symptoms.

For schizophrenia, brain imaging may reveal structural abnormalities such as enlarged ventricles or reduced gray matter in certain regions. Functional imaging might show atypical patterns of brain activity during cognitive tasks. These observations, combined with clinical evaluation, can support the diagnostic process.

Anxiety disorders have also been associated with observable changes in brain structure and function. MRI may reveal alterations in areas such as the amygdala and prefrontal cortex, which play critical roles in fear processing and emotional regulation.

Obsessive-compulsive disorder (OCD) has been linked to abnormalities in the corticostriatal circuits, which can be visualized using advanced MRI techniques. These imaging findings help researchers understand the neural basis of OCD symptoms and may guide the development of more targeted treatments.

Neurodegenerative conditions like Alzheimer's disease and other forms of dementia can be monitored through MRI, which may show progressive changes in brain structure over time. This capability is particularly valuable for tracking disease progression and evaluating treatment response.

Benefits of MRI in Mental Health Assessment

The integration of MRI into mental health assessment offers several significant advantages. One primary benefit is the ability to identify structural abnormalities in the brain that may be associated with mental illness. These findings can help validate the biological basis of psychiatric conditions and reduce stigma by demonstrating that mental health disorders have measurable physical correlates.

MRI also plays a crucial role in ruling out other potential causes of psychiatric symptoms. For patients presenting with new or severe mental health concerns, imaging can help exclude neurological conditions such as brain tumors, strokes, or traumatic brain injuries that might mimic psychiatric symptoms. This differential diagnostic capability ensures that patients receive appropriate treatment for their actual condition.

The detailed information provided by MRI enables more personalized treatment planning. By identifying which brain regions are affected in a particular individual, clinicians can tailor interventions to target those specific areas. This precision medicine approach may improve treatment outcomes and reduce the trial-and-error often associated with psychiatric medication management.

The non-invasive nature of MRI makes it accessible to most patients without requiring sedation or anesthesia. This safety profile allows for repeated scanning when necessary to monitor treatment response or track disease progression over time.

Early detection of mental health conditions represents another significant benefit of MRI technology. For individuals at risk for disorders such as depression or schizophrenia, imaging may reveal subtle brain changes before clinical symptoms become apparent. Early identification enables proactive intervention that might delay symptom onset or reduce the severity of the condition.

Limitations and Considerations

Despite its advantages, MRI has important limitations in the context of mental health assessment. The most significant constraint is that MRI cannot diagnose mental illness on its own. Mental health conditions are complex and multifactorial, requiring comprehensive evaluation through clinical interviews, behavioral assessments, and consideration of personal history.

The structural and functional variations observed in MRI scans of individuals with mental health conditions often overlap significantly with those found in healthy populations. This lack of specificity means that imaging findings cannot confirm the presence of a psychiatric disorder.

Standard MRI techniques may not detect subtle brain abnormalities associated with certain mental health conditions. While advanced methods like DTI and high-field scanners offer improved resolution, they are not yet widely available for routine clinical use.

The interpretation of MRI findings requires specialized expertise, and there can be variability in how different clinicians evaluate the same scans. This subjectivity may affect the consistency of results across different healthcare settings.

Cost and accessibility also present challenges. MRI scans are expensive, and insurance coverage for purely psychiatric indications may be limited. Additionally, the availability of advanced MRI techniques varies significantly across different healthcare systems and geographic regions.

Current Research and Future Directions

Research into the application of MRI for mental health assessment continues to advance rapidly. Scientists are exploring how imaging technology might improve early detection of conditions such as depression and schizophrenia in at-risk individuals. These efforts aim to identify biomarkers that could predict the onset of mental health disorders before symptoms become apparent.

Functional imaging is being investigated as a tool for monitoring treatment response in psychiatric conditions. By observing changes in brain activity before and after intervention, researchers hope to develop more objective measures of treatment effectiveness than traditional symptom assessment alone.

The development of imaging biomarkers for mood regulation and cognitive function represents another promising research direction. These objective biological measures could supplement clinical evaluation and provide more standardized assessment across different patients and settings.

Artificial intelligence and machine learning are increasingly being applied to MRI data analysis. These technologies can identify complex patterns across large datasets that might not be apparent to human observers. The integration of AI with MRI has the potential to improve diagnostic accuracy and identify new associations between brain structure/function and mental health conditions.

Advanced imaging techniques continue to evolve, with researchers developing increasingly sensitive methods for detecting subtle brain abnormalities. These innovations promise to expand our understanding of the neurological basis of mental health conditions and improve diagnostic capabilities.

When an MRI Might Be Recommended for Mental Health Concerns

Healthcare professionals may recommend a brain MRI in specific clinical situations. For patients presenting with new or severe psychiatric symptoms that are atypical or difficult to explain, imaging can help identify potential neurological causes.

When symptoms suggest a possible brain tumor, traumatic brain injury, or other neurological disorder, MRI may be ordered to rule out these conditions. This is particularly relevant when psychiatric symptoms develop suddenly or in individuals with no prior history of mental health concerns.

For patients with treatment-resistant mental health conditions, MRI might provide insights into potential biological factors contributing to treatment resistance. These findings could guide alternative treatment approaches.

In research settings, MRI is frequently used to study the neurological underpinnings of mental health conditions. Participation in research studies may provide access to advanced imaging techniques not yet available in clinical practice.

Individuals with a family history of neurological conditions or those experiencing cognitive changes in addition to psychiatric symptoms may benefit from MRI evaluation to assess for potential neurodegenerative processes.
